AKITA Coin, often associated with its Shiba Inu mascot, is a decentralized meme token inspired by community-driven projects like Dogecoin. Operating primarily on the Ethereum blockchain, it functions as an ERC-20 token, emphasizing fun, engagement, and collective participation rather than complex technological promises. Its creation stems from internet culture, leveraging social media and online communities to build momentum and foster a dedicated following.
Understanding AKITA Coin’s Origins and Purpose
AKITA Coin emerged during the meme token surge, drawing inspiration from the Shiba Inu dog breed, which gained notoriety through Dogecoin. Unlike many cryptocurrencies with explicit utility goals, AKITA positions itself as a community-centric asset. It thrives on social interaction, online engagement, and viral trends, making it appealing to enthusiasts who value humor and cultural relevance in the crypto space.
The project’s founders designed it to be accessible, with a decentralized structure that allows holders to participate in community decisions. While it lacks the technical sophistication of some blockchain projects, its charm lies in its simplicity and strong online presence.
Key Features of AKITA Coin
AKITA Coin incorporates several characteristics common to meme tokens:
- Community Governance: Holders often influence project directions through decentralized voting mechanisms.
- Social Media Integration: It relies heavily on platforms like Twitter, Reddit, and Discord for promotion and updates.
- Scarcity Mechanisms: Some versions implement token burning to reduce supply and increase scarcity over time.
- Compatibility: As an ERC-20 token, it is compatible with Ethereum-based wallets and decentralized exchanges.
These features contribute to its identity as a lighthearted yet potentially valuable digital asset in the broader cryptocurrency ecosystem.
Market Performance and Historical Trends
Like many meme coins, AKITA has experienced significant price volatility. Its value is heavily influenced by market sentiment, social media trends, and broader cryptocurrency movements. During bull markets, it often sees rapid appreciation driven by retail investor enthusiasm. Conversely, it can decline sharply during market downturns.
Historical data shows that AKITA’s performance correlates with major crypto events, such as Bitcoin’s price swings or surges in popular meme tokens. Investors should note that its price action is less tied to technological advancements and more to community engagement and speculative trading.

Risks and Considerations for Investors
Investing in AKITA Coin involves notable risks:
- High Volatility: Prices can change dramatically in short periods.
- Speculative Nature: Value is largely driven by sentiment, not fundamentals.
- Regulatory Uncertainty: Evolving laws may impact meme tokens differently.
- Liquidity Challenges: Some exchanges may have limited trading pairs.
Prospective investors should conduct thorough research, invest only what they can afford to lose, and diversify their portfolios to mitigate potential losses.
